I have tried to fix a PC today, a Windows 98 machine that has a failing hard
drive and I tried to run Scandisk and it would not work at all. It was
trying to
move data from one part of the hard drive to another to fix damaged sectors
of
the hard drive and it could not manage it as the hard drive is failing. And
he
had problems with pop up windows on his machine, which is running Internet
Explorer 5.0. Which is a heap of garbage by the way. Anyway, he is having a
heap of
problems, but at least I could try and fix the problems with the popups, I
just
installed Google Toolbar and that was fixed. He may need a new hard drive
though, best to put the new one in with the old one and use Windows Explorer
to
copy the data over after setting up the drive with FDISK. Should be simple.
If
the hard drive is going to fail, then there is not much that can be done
about
it. Very annoying, but if you catch it in time you can be alright.
